Stuck on a question?
Eliminate wrong answers.
This increases your chances of selecting the right one by reducing your options.
Practice makes perfect!
Use authentic GRE practice tests to familiarize yourself with the timing and format.
Time management is key to success
Try to answer each question in 1 minute and 30 seconds.
Set timers during practice to boost your speed.
Word problems can be tricky, but with practice:
Solve the problem step-by-step.
Convert words into mathematical expressions.
Acquire effective techniques such as entering numbers for algebraic expressions.
Approximations are used for complex computations.
These techniques save time
Refresh your knowledge of mental math.
Divide, multiply, subtract, and add without a calculator.
This ability expedites the process of solving problems.
